Does San Marcos Consolidated Independent School sponsor H-1B visas?

Yes. San Marcos Consolidated Independent School has filed 2 H-1B LCAs with the U.S. Department of Labor between FY2023 and FY2026. In FY2023 San Marcos Consolidated Independent School filed 2 H-1B LCAs at a median base salary of $52,750. No PERM green-card cases are on record.

It files most often for Elementary Bilingual Teacher roles, most in San Marcos, TX.
